Version: 0.9.66.dev.260504

后端:
1. 阶段 2 user/auth 服务边界落地,新增 `cmd/userauth` go-zero zrpc 服务、`services/userauth` 核心实现、gateway user API/zrpc client 与 shared contracts/ports,迁移注册、登录、刷新 token、登出、JWT、黑名单和 token 额度治理
2. gateway 与启动装配切流,`cmd/all` 只保留边缘路由、鉴权和轻量组合,通过 userauth zrpc 访问核心用户能力;拆分 MySQL/Redis 初始化与 AutoMigrate 边界,`userauth` 自迁 `users` 和 token 记账幂等表,`all` 不再迁用户表
3. 清退 Gin 单体旧 user/auth DAO、model、service、router、middleware 和 JWT handler,并同步调整 agent/schedule/cache/outbox 相关调用依赖
4. 补齐 refresh token 防并发重放、MySQL 幂等 token 记账、额度 `>=` 拦截和 RPC 错误映射,避免重复记账与内部错误透出

文档:
1. 新增《学习计划论坛与Token商店PRD》

package userauth
import (
"errors"
"fmt"
"strings"
"github.com/LoveLosita/smartflow/backend/respond"
"google.golang.org/genproto/googleapis/rpc/errdetails"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
)
// responseFromRPCError 负责把 user/auth 的 gRPC 错误反解回项目内的 respond.Response。
//
// 职责边界:
// 1. 只在 gateway 边缘层使用,不下沉到服务实现里;
// 2. 业务错误尽量恢复成 respond.Response方便 API 层继续复用现有 DealWithError
// 3. 只要拿不到业务语义,就退化成普通 error让上层按 500 处理。
func responseFromRPCError(err error) error {
if err == nil {
return nil
}
st, ok := status.FromError(err)
if !ok {
return wrapRPCError(err)
}
if resp, ok := responseFromStatus(st); ok {
return resp
}
switch st.Code() {
case codes.Internal, codes.Unknown, codes.Unavailable, codes.DeadlineExceeded, codes.DataLoss, codes.Unimplemented:
msg := strings.TrimSpace(st.Message())
if msg == "" {
msg = "userauth zrpc service internal error"
}
return wrapRPCError(errors.New(msg))
}
msg := strings.TrimSpace(st.Message())
if msg == "" {
msg = "userauth zrpc service rejected request"
}
return respond.Response{
Status: grpcCodeToRespondStatus(st.Code()),
Info: msg,
}
}
func responseFromStatus(st *status.Status) (respond.Response, bool) {
if st == nil {
return respond.Response{}, false
}
if resp, ok := responseFromStatusDetails(st); ok {
return resp, true
}
if resp, ok := responseFromLegacyStatus(st.Code(), st.Message()); ok {
return resp, true
}
return respond.Response{}, false
}
func responseFromStatusDetails(st *status.Status) (respond.Response, bool) {
for _, detail := range st.Details() {
info, ok := detail.(*errdetails.ErrorInfo)
if !ok {
continue
}
statusValue := strings.TrimSpace(info.Reason)
if statusValue == "" {
statusValue = grpcCodeToRespondStatus(st.Code())
}
if statusValue == "" {
return respond.Response{}, false
}
message := strings.TrimSpace(st.Message())
if message == "" && info.Metadata != nil {
message = strings.TrimSpace(info.Metadata["info"])
}
if message == "" {
message = statusValue
}
return respond.Response{Status: statusValue, Info: message}, true
}
return respond.Response{}, false
}
func responseFromLegacyStatus(code codes.Code, message string) (respond.Response, bool) {
trimmed := strings.TrimSpace(message)
if resp, ok := respondResponseByMessage(trimmed); ok {
return resp, true
}
switch code {
case codes.Unauthenticated:
if trimmed == "" {
trimmed = "unauthorized"
}
return respond.Response{Status: respond.ErrUnauthorized.Status, Info: trimmed}, true
case codes.AlreadyExists:
if trimmed == "" {
trimmed = "already exists"
}
return respond.Response{Status: respond.InvalidName.Status, Info: trimmed}, true
case codes.NotFound:
if trimmed == "" {
trimmed = "not found"
}
return respond.Response{Status: respond.WrongName.Status, Info: trimmed}, true
case codes.ResourceExhausted:
if trimmed == "" {
trimmed = respond.TokenUsageExceedsLimit.Info
}
return respond.Response{Status: respond.TokenUsageExceedsLimit.Status, Info: trimmed}, true
case codes.InvalidArgument:
if trimmed == "" {
trimmed = "invalid argument"
}
return respond.Response{Status: respond.MissingParam.Status, Info: trimmed}, true
case codes.Internal, codes.Unknown, codes.DataLoss:
if trimmed == "" {
trimmed = "userauth service internal error"
}
return respond.InternalError(errors.New(trimmed)), true
}
return respond.Response{}, false
}
func respondResponseByMessage(message string) (respond.Response, bool) {
switch strings.TrimSpace(message) {
case respond.MissingParam.Info:
return respond.MissingParam, true
case respond.WrongParamType.Info:
return respond.WrongParamType, true
case respond.ParamTooLong.Info:
return respond.ParamTooLong, true
case respond.InvalidName.Info:
return respond.InvalidName, true
case respond.WrongName.Info:
return respond.WrongName, true
case respond.WrongPwd.Info:
return respond.WrongPwd, true
case respond.WrongUsernameOrPwd.Info:
return respond.WrongUsernameOrPwd, true
case respond.MissingToken.Info:
return respond.MissingToken, true
case respond.InvalidTokenSingingMethod.Info:
return respond.InvalidTokenSingingMethod, true
case respond.InvalidToken.Info:
return respond.InvalidToken, true
case respond.InvalidClaims.Info:
return respond.InvalidClaims, true
case respond.ErrUnauthorized.Info:
return respond.ErrUnauthorized, true
case respond.InvalidRefreshToken.Info:
return respond.InvalidRefreshToken, true
case respond.WrongTokenType.Info:
return respond.WrongTokenType, true
case respond.UserLoggedOut.Info:
return respond.UserLoggedOut, true
case respond.WrongUserID.Info:
return respond.WrongUserID, true
case respond.TokenUsageExceedsLimit.Info:
return respond.TokenUsageExceedsLimit, true
}
return respond.Response{}, false
}
func grpcCodeToRespondStatus(code codes.Code) string {
switch code {
case codes.Unauthenticated:
return respond.ErrUnauthorized.Status
case codes.AlreadyExists:
return respond.InvalidName.Status
case codes.NotFound:
return respond.WrongName.Status
case codes.ResourceExhausted:
return respond.TokenUsageExceedsLimit.Status
case codes.Internal, codes.Unknown, codes.DataLoss:
return "500"
default:
return "400"
}
}
func wrapRPCError(err error) error {
if err == nil {
return nil
}
return fmt.Errorf("调用 userauth zrpc 服务失败: %w", err)
}
